Am 06.05.2015 um 12:53 schrieb Michael Biebl: > Am 04.05.2015 um 13:15 schrieb Bernd Zeimetz: >> Even worse, pressing enter shows the prompt from the former shell and >> I'm able to get 'bash ... command not found errors' > > This looks like a bug in /sbin/sulogin, which does not properly cleanup > it's children, when being killed. > Our /sbin/sulogin implementation comes from sysvinit-utils while > apparently most other distros use /sbin/sulogin from util-linux nowadays. I tested with sulogin from util-linux and can confirm that this particular bug doesn't happen with that implementation. Since util-linux is properly maintained upstream we should consider shipping that implementation. This also get's us closer to what other distros use and allows us to eventually get rid of sysvinit-utils and src:sysvinit. I also think we should move the following tools (along with their man pages) to util-linux while at it: /usr/bin/lastb /usr/bin/last /usr/bin/mesg /sbin/sulogin This needs coordination between sysvinit-utils and util-linux, so cloning and re-assigning the bug accordingly.
